Duke will have a chance to avenge its gut-wrenching Elite Eight defeat to UConn next season when the Blue Devils and Huskies face off in Las Vegas on Nov. 25.

That matchup will mark the first of three marquee Duke non-conference games Amazon will broadcast during the 2026-27 campaign as part of the ever-growing retailer and streaming service’s new partnership with the university.

Prime Video announced the slate, and ESPN fleshed out the details in a Thursday report.
